I've run my 90 gal for 4-6 weeks without a skimmer. I've been having algae problems. So i broke down and purchase a Coralife Super Skimmer (rated for 125 gals). I'll let you know if it reduces the algae problems. By the way I have to run this a HOT. Does anyone know how to reduce the microbubbles. I read the 101 pages on another post.
 
I have a CSS 125;)

Does a great job!.. As for the bubbles, i keep the water level over the bubble diffuser box. I generally dry skim or semi wet. I pull alot of stinky gunk with that thing. I was impressed for the price. I use mine as a HOT in my sump due to small remaining foot print from various other pumps, heater and probes. I have no bubbles in my display.

I use the foam intake filter off of a Mag Drive pump. It is much smaller than the stock box that comes with it. It slips right over the tube on the skimmer.
The CSS are great skimmers for the money.
